      Global status: skipped
      •	Job ID: 8b655439-8646-42b5-8088-5a1c7bc535c4
      •	Run ID: 1555884000001
      •	mode: full
      •	Start time: Monday, April 22nd 2019, 12:00:00 am
      •	End time: Monday, April 22nd 2019, 12:00:00 am
      •	Duration: a few seconds
      •	Error: no such object 2be5c054-6f96-72a7-74d0-8b81b7fce3ec
      •	⚠️ missingVms
      

      I don't see 2be5c054-6f96-72a7-74d0-8b81b7fce3ec in vm-list, but how to identify this vm in xoa backup task? I guess I need to remove some machine from machinesd list?

        1. If you have pro support, I would suggest you use it 🙂
        2. Anyway, I edited your post to use correct markdown syntax otherwise it's hard to read
        3. Just copy/paste the UUID in the search field of home/VM view
        4. I would suggest for that number of VM that you use smart mode and rely on tags 🙂
